Use Names Activities Search to find activities associated with Name records within a specified timeframe.

  1. Click Activities on the main toolbar
  2. Click the Name icon
  3. Enter Activity created Date Range
  4. Select the number of records per page
  5. Select the Order By (sort preference)
  6. In Text Search, you can filter by the text written to the Activity Text area.
  7. Select Additional Filters (OPTIONAL). Separate multiple values with a comma.
    • Filter by Company Name
    • Filter by User Name
    • Filter by Activity Type
    • Filter by Rollup List
    • Filter by Last Name
    • Filter by First Name
    • Filter by Position Id (Returns all activities for names in the pipeline for selected position)
    • Select Activity Types to be excluded
  8. Click the Search action icon.  Once you return the activities, you can print results, rollup the names into a list, or bulk email the names.

Use Company Activities to find activities associated with Company records during a specified timeframe. Learn how to write activities here.

  1. Click Activities on the main toolbar
  2. Click the Company icon
  3. Enter Activity created Date Range
  4. Select the number of records per page
  5. Select the Order By (sort preference)
  6. In the Text Search, you can filter by the text written to the Activity Text area.
  7. Select Additional Filters (OPTIONAL). Separate multiple values with a comma.
    • Filter by Company Name
    • Filter by User Name
    • Filter by Activity Type
    • Filter by Rollup
    • Select Activity Types to be excluded
  8. Click the Search action icon. Once you return the activities, you can print results or rollup the companies into a list.

Use Position Activities to find activities associated with Position records within a specified timeframe.  Learn how to write activities here.

  1. Click Activities on the main toolbar
  2. Click the Position icon
  3. Enter Activity created Date Range
  4. Select the number of records per page
  5. Select the Order By (sort preference)
  6. In the Text Search, you can filter by the text written to the Activity Text area.
  7. Select Additional Filters (OPTIONAL). Separate multiple values with a comma.
    • Filter by Job Title
    • Filter by Company Name
    • Filter by Position Id
    • Filter by Department
    • Filter by Activity Type
    • Filter by User Name
    • Filter by Rollup List
    • Select Activity Types to be excluded
  8. Click the Search action icon. Once you return the activities, you can print results or rollup the positions into a list.

Use Interview Activities to find Pipeline records created within a specified timeframe. Not sure how to create pipeline records? Click here to learn more.  

  1. Click Activities on the main toolbar
  2. Click the Interview icon
  3. Enter the Date Range, then use the Order By to specify to base the results on Appointment/Start/Begin Date, or the Arranged/Placed Date.
  4. Select Additional Filters (OPTIONAL)
    • Filter by Company Name
    • Filter by User Name
    • Filter by Position Id
    • Filter by Job Title
    • Filter by Department
    • Filter by Last Name (Candidate)
    • Filter by Interview Type/Status (Pipeline Template/Step)
  5. Click the Search action icon. Once you return the interview records, you can print results, rollup the candidates into a list, or bulk email the candidates.
